Brookfield Business Partners LP
INDUSTRIALS · CONGLOMERATES · USA
Brookfield Business Partners LP (BBU) is a leading global alternative asset manager that focuses on acquiring, operating, and enhancing a diversified portfolio of high-quality, cash-generating businesses. Capitalizing on the robust resources and expertise of its parent company, Brookfield Asset Management, BBU strategically invests in sectors such as industrials, utilities, and consumer products, employing a disciplined approach to operational improvements. With an emphasis on delivering sustainable cash distributions and capital appreciation, BBU is well-equipped to capitalize on growth opportunities, positioning itself to generate superior returns for its investors over the long term.

TECHNOLOGY · CONSUMER ELECTRONICS · USA
LG Display Co., Ltd. is dedicated to the design, manufacture and sale of thin film transistor liquid crystal displays (TFT-LCD) and display panels based on organic light emitting diode (OLED) technology. The company is headquartered in Seoul, South Korea.
